Reviewed by bret717 from Pennsylvania
4.17/5 rDev +9.7%
look: 4.25 | smell: 4 | taste: 4.25 | feel: 4 | overall: 4.25
4.17/5 rDev +9.7%
look: 4.25 | smell: 4 | taste: 4.25 | feel: 4 | overall: 4.25
best by 1/18/19, reviewed 11/6/18
Look- dark brown liquid that's ruby-hued around the edges of the glass, nice fluffy head that recedes very slowly, leaving about a half finger; sheets of lacing
Smell- bakers chocolate, roasty char, something vaguely fruity, like berries
Taste- bitter roasty char and chocolate up front followed by a mild fruity note which comes off more citrus-like in the flavor
Feel- medium-bodied with above average carbonation, finishes semi-dry with lingering mild bitterness
Overall- this is a nice take on an a porter with classic roasty and chocolate notes accompanied by mildly fruity hops

Reviewed by IronLover from Pennsylvania
3.77/5 rDev -0.8%
look: 4.5 | smell: 3.75 | taste: 3.75 | feel: 3.5 | overall: 3.75
3.77/5 rDev -0.8%
look: 4.5 | smell: 3.75 | taste: 3.75 | feel: 3.5 | overall: 3.75
Deep mahogany brown in color with good clarity. Poured with a tall, dense, rocky, light tan foam with excellent retention. Grainy and sweet dark malt aromas with light roasted notes and a hint of dark chocolate. On the lighter side of medium bodied with soft, medium high carbonation with light smoothness through the middle. Grainy, dark malt flavors up front followed by medium bitterness and dark roasted malt flavors through the middle. Roasted and dark malt flavors persist from to the end. Finished with a lingering bitter roasted malt aftertaste. Beautiful appearance. Malt flavor and aroma was on the grainy side. Generally, the malt character was a little low for the style. Feel was on the thin side.

Oct 17, 2017Reviewed by Lone_Freighter from Vermont
3.69/5 rDev -2.9%
look: 3.75 | smell: 3.5 | taste: 3.75 | feel: 3.75 | overall: 3.75
3.69/5 rDev -2.9%
look: 3.75 | smell: 3.5 | taste: 3.75 | feel: 3.75 | overall: 3.75
The appearance was a dark brown close to black color with a one finger white to off white foamy head that dissipates within about a minute and leaves a decent amount of foamy lacing. The smell was roasty and bitter coffee pervading through some light caramel, chocolate and oatmeal. The taste took those flavors and combined it wonderfully. There was a nice bitter coffee aftertaste that ended up leaving a dry finish. On the palate, it sat about a medium on the body with a quality that wanted to show a decent sessionability but kinda made me sip it. The carbonation was good for the style and for me as it was slightly smooth and creamy. Overall, I say this was a good American Porter well worthy of having again.
